Gaming is quickly becoming one of the most promising sectors on Solana.

Why?

  • Fast transactions enable real-time interactions
  • Low fees make microtransactions viable
  • Scalable infrastructure supports large user bases

As gaming grows, it brings new users into the ecosystem.

About Solana

  • Solana is a highly functional open source project that banks on blockchain technology’s permissionless nature to provide decentralized finance (DeFi) solutions. While the idea and initial work on the project began in 2017, Solana was officially launched in March 2020 by the Solana Foundation with headquarters in Geneva, Switzerland.

  • The Solana protocol is designed to facilitate decentralized app (DApp) creation. It aims to improve scalability by introducing a proof-of-history (PoH) consensus combined with the underlying proof-of-stake (PoS) consensus of the blockchain.
